Title :
Energetic macroscopic representation of a multiple architecture heavy duty hybrid vehicle

Abstract :
This paper presents the energetic macroscopic representation (EMR) of a multiple architecture heavy duty hybrid vehicle. The vehicle is a mobile test bench for an ldquoElectrical Chain Components Evaluationrdquo (ECCE). The aims of this paper are: 1) To develop the different energetic macroscopic representations of the vehicle, 2) To present different energetic configurations using the available power and energy sources (super capacitors, fuel cell system, internal combustion engine, flywheel system and batteries).
